Northern Fleet's DES Yaroslavl put afloat after dock repairs at Nerpa shipyard

09/25/2009 
Northern Fleet's diesel-electric submarine (DES) B-808 Yaroslavl put afloat after dock repairs at Nerpa shipyard, Snezhnogorsk branch of Zvezdochka shipyard, said official from the parent enterprise's press-service.

"The DES has passed full-scale overhaul under the contract with Defense Ministry", said the press-service representative.

DES Yaroslavl was constructed in 1988 and was initially basing in the Black Sea Fleet. In 2007 it made an unofficial visit to the main Norwegian naval base Hokonsvern – for the first time in the history of bilateral relations.

Yaroslavl is 887EKM-project submarine developed in Rubin bureau of maritime technologies (St. Petersburg). Such DESs have displacement of 2 300 t, length of 72.6 m, underwater speed of 19 knots (about 35 kph), submergence depth of 300 m, crew of 52, and fuel endurance of 45 days. Armament is six 533-mm torpedo tubes.
